Choose
Wall St. Rank if…
- You need fund manager portfolios: browse holdings & stats for the largest funds and ‘superinvestors’ across quarters (aum filters, turnover, holdings counts).
- You need fund trends: aggregate ‘common fund bets,’ largest buys/sells, and options exposures (calls/puts) derived from filings.
- You need analyst intelligence: live ratings & price‑target feed; analyst and research‑firm profiles; ‘analyst upside’ consensus views.
- You need wsr indexes: a fund manager index based on fund-manager consensus and updated quarterly; analyst index is still marked coming soon.
